4 injured in fight for cricket pitch in South Delhi park

Four persons, including a teenager, were injured in a clash between two groups over fight for a cricket pitch at a park in south Delhi's Mehrauli, police said today.
The police were informed about the quarrel around 6 pm yesterday.
When the police reached the Jamali Kamali Park, four persons were found there in injured conditions, an official said, adding they were rushed to a nearby hospital.
The injured were identified as Abdul Samad (18), Sandeep (21), Nikhil (21) and Gokul (21), the police official said.
Sandeep said they had taken beer to celebrate birthday of their friend Narender and play cricket with tennis ball in the park, according to the official.
Later, around five local boys arrived and insisted on using the pitch on which they were playing. While an argument broke out betweeen the two sides, Abdul opened a kit bag containing a small knife and stabbed Sandeep and also attacked his friends, the official said.
Abdul's friends Arman and Daanish fled the spot.
Some locals had alleged that the two sides got into a quarrel over a religious issue but the police denied the contention.
